Here at Malloy Aeronautics Limited, we specialise in the development of heavy lift unmanned air vehicles (UAVs) for both civilian and military uses. Located in Berkshire, our operations are notable for their focus on in-house design and manufacturing. This vertical integration means we control the production of most aircraft components on-site, enhancing our ability to innovate and maintain high standards across all stages of development.

Job title: Product Safety Engineer 

Location: Maidenhead, Berkshire 

Salary: Negotiable 

How to apply:  Send a CV and cover letter to enquiries@malloyaeronautics.com  

About The Role: 
As a Safety Engineer, you will be reporting to the Chief Engineer. This exciting role will place the right candidate at the forefront of unmanned air systems development in the UK. 

We seek a highly motivated engineer to oversee the development and implementation of safety processes for UAS systems. As a Safety Engineer, you will drive the integration of safety requirements into engineering designs, ensuring compliance with regulatory standards and industry best practices. You will apply your expertise in safety engineering and risk management to assess hazards, develop safety cases, and maintain product integrity throughout the lifecycle. Additionally, you will collaborate with cross-functional teams to promote a strong safety culture, providing guidance, training, and continuous improvement initiatives across the organization. 


Ability to hold Security Clearance – 5 years residence in the UK 

Key role responsibilities: 
•    Evaluation of aircraft and system / sub-system design safety in support of platform safety certification throughout the Engineering Lifecycle 
•    Generating, updating and reviewing Aircraft, System and Sub-System System Safety Engineering tasks such as 
•    Decomposition of safety requirements at all relevant product levels (Weapon Platform, System, Sub-System, Equipment) 
•    Zonal Hazard Analysis Reports (ZHAs) 
•    Preliminary Hazard List (PHL) 
•    Preliminary Hazard Analysis (PHA) 
•    System / Sub-System Hazard Analysis 
•    Validation of supplier safety analysis / documentation. 
•    System / sub-system safety assessment reports, including safety analysis (fault tree analysis etc.) 
•    Ensuring that Certification evidence supports achievement of an acceptable level of product design safety wrt Design Airworthiness requirements and identified hazards 
•    Assess customer deviations from the design for adverse impact on product integrity and identify recovery route (where necessary) 
•    Support the project teams, support and service engineering organisations with the generation of Risk Assessments, ensuring suitable justification exists for action and the adequacy of the proposed remedial / recovery action in mitigating Product safety risk / safety performance degradation 
•    Undertake the communication and management of residual risk through the appropriate process 
•    Manage and report any outstanding product integrity actions/issues through to closure

Job title: UAV Pilot

Salary: Negotiable (depending on experience)

Location: Maidenhead, Berkshire 

How to apply:  Send a CV and cover letter to enquiries@malloyaeronautics.com  

About The Role:
Reporting to the Chief Operations Pilot, the successful candidate will be fulfilling a diverse range of flying tasking within an industry leading UAS company, on some of the largest and most advanced uncrewed Air Systems in the world.

The role will include production testing of newly manufactured UAVs, trials flying to explore the envelope of new and nascent designs, instructing both military and civil clients from all over the world to operate our platforms and demonstration flying to showcase our products and their capabilities to new customers. This tasking is often away from our home site, and the role offers fantastic opportunity for travel, diverse flying tasks on a wide array of new and varied platforms, and industry leading training and professional development.

In addition to flying tasking, the successful candidate will assist in supporting the running of the flight operations department including logistics, maintenance, equipment set up and safety management, forming a vital part of safe and efficient operation of our aircraft both on the ground and in the air.

The role represents an exciting opportunity for an experienced UAV pilot, offering excellent career progression and the opportunity to join a fantastic, inclusive and growing team within an industry leading company.

Ability to hold Security Clearance – 5 years residence in the UK

What we are looking for (but not limited to):
The ideal candidate will have a solid foundation of UAV experience including flying in manual modes on Specific category (S2) platforms, preferably more than 50 Hours solo flight. BVLOS experience is highly desirable. Flight Testing or demonstration experience would also be incredibly valued.

Any experience of maritime / marine operations, flight testing and flight trials would all be of substantial value. Experience in the military UAS realm or commercial sector would further be highly desirable, but candidates from all backgrounds who meet the requisite standard for interview will be considered.

The right candidate must also be highly flexible to support operational tasking both at home and overseas. An ability to quickly assimilate and retain new information is likewise vital to keep up with a fast-paced operational tempo, and to support the continued development and rapid prototyping of new products fielded to respond to new challenges, and emerging opportunities.

Given the requisite responsibility for the safe conduct of their flying operations, they must be able to deliver tasking independently, including demonstrating robust decision-making skills and an exemplary approach to safety. We’re looking for a candidate that is reliable, self-sufficient, experienced, and above all, does not rest on their laurels, but instead is eager to continually develop.

Job title: Senior Battery Integration Engineer
Location: Maidenhead, Berkshire
Salary Range: Negotiable
How to apply:  Send a CV and cover letter to enquiries@malloyaeronautics.com

The Malloy Aeronautics Team:
Malloy Aeronautics Limited specializes in the development of heavy lift unmanned air vehicles (UAVs) for both civilian and military uses. Located in Berkshire, our operations are notable for their focus on in-house design and manufacturing. This vertical integration means we control the production of most aircraft components on-site, enhancing our ability to innovate and maintain high standards across all stages of development.


About The Role:
Malloy Aeronautics are looking for an engineer with experience working with pouch cell integration to join our concept development team. This role will focus on the development of batteries from a set of requirements to production product. This role suits an engineer who has a broad skillset across battery design elements and enjoys spending time hands-on building and testing.
Ability to hold Security Clearance – 5 years residence in the UK

What you’ll being doing:

  • Leading the physical design of Malloy’s battery platforms developing packs from a concept stage to production.
  • Interface with other engineering groups on collaborative projects to deconflict integration issues and execute against project plans.
  • Developing test and validation plans for battery packs, and analysing test data to refine pack design
  • Developing prototype and/or concept battery packs with novel technologies
  • Working with and supporting suppliers to ensure parts are on time and designed to best suit their needs.
  • Generating technical documentation, reports, and supporting build guide development
     

Essential Skills and Experiences:

  • Relevant degree in engineering
  • Prior in-depth experience in battery pack design and cell integration.
  • Experience using, designing, integrating and packaging pouch cells.
  • Experience with battery thermal management methodologies.
  • Knowledge of cell connection methodologies including laser welding.
  • Experience with a wide variety of production processes including but not limited to lathe, 3-5 axis machining, water jet, laser cut, punch, bending, welding, casting, various 3d printing types and injection moulding.
  • Experience using CAD software, ideally SolidWorks.
  • Experience designing for high voltage applications and relevant practical high voltage training (preferably SAP/level 3)
  • Knowledge of project lifecycle management, developing requirements, and working in a gated design environment.
     

Desired Skills and Experiences:

  • Experience in high-performance and/or high pack factor battery applications such as motorsport, aerospace, etc.
  • Electrochemical knowledge & experience in lab environment
  • Pack simulation using FEA/CFD packages (thermals, electrical simulation, vibration etc.)
  • Experience working with mass critical systems
  • Experience with high vibration applications
  • Familiarity with text-based programming
  • Knowledge of battery testing standards
